Skip to content

Cart

Your cart is empty

Toys

Award-winning toys for 2025—Designed in Japan, shipped from the UK.

LanternLantern
Lantern Sale price£48.00
NookNook
Nook Sale price£60.00
CarouselCarousel
Carousel Sale price£36.00